Management of ADHD Combined Type with Inadequate Response to Adderall ER 10mg

The best next step for a patient with ADHD combined type showing no improvement on Adderall ER 10mg is to titrate the dose upward to achieve maximum benefit with minimum adverse effects. 1

Medication Optimization Algorithm

Step 1: Dose Titration

  • Current situation: Patient on Adderall ER 10mg with no improvement
  • Action: Increase Adderall ER dose by 5-10mg weekly
  • Target: Approximately 1.2 mg/kg/day (not exceeding 1.4 mg/kg/day or 100mg total daily dose, whichever is less) 1
  • Maximum dose: 50-60mg daily for adults 1

Step 2: If Dose Titration Fails

If the patient experiences dose-limiting side effects or inadequate response despite optimal dosing:

  1. Switch to another stimulant class:

    • Consider methylphenidate formulations (Concerta, Ritalin LA) 2
    • Different mechanism of action may provide better response
  2. Switch to a non-stimulant medication:

    • Atomoxetine (starting at 40mg daily, target 80mg daily, maximum 100mg) 3
    • Extended-release guanfacine or clonidine 1
    • These options have lower abuse potential if diversion is a concern
  3. Combination therapy:

    • Add atomoxetine, extended-release guanfacine, or extended-release clonidine to a partial response with stimulants 2
    • Combined pharmacotherapy and behavioral therapy may be more effective than medication alone 1, 4

Monitoring During Dose Adjustment

  • Schedule follow-up within 2-4 weeks after dose changes 5
  • Assess core ADHD symptoms using standardized rating scales
  • Monitor for common side effects: insomnia, decreased appetite, headache, irritability
  • Track vital signs, particularly blood pressure and heart rate
  • Evaluate weight changes, especially in younger patients

Important Considerations

  • Low initial dose: 10mg of Adderall ER is often a starting dose, not a therapeutic dose for most patients 3
  • Therapeutic window: Many patients require higher doses to achieve symptom control
  • Delayed response: Some patients may not show improvement until reaching adequate dosage
  • Adherence assessment: Confirm medication is being taken as prescribed before concluding ineffectiveness

Common Pitfalls to Avoid

  1. Premature switching to another medication class before optimizing the current stimulant dose
  2. Failure to address comorbid conditions that may impact ADHD treatment response
  3. Inadequate duration of treatment at therapeutic doses before determining effectiveness
  4. Not considering extended coverage needs for functioning throughout the day
  5. Overlooking psychosocial interventions that can enhance medication effectiveness 1

Long-term studies show that stimulant medications like mixed amphetamine salts can provide sustained symptomatic improvement for up to 24 months when properly dosed 6, making dose optimization a critical first step before considering alternative treatments.
